Peter Lindman
Peter Lindman is a San Francisco-based musician known for his acoustic performances featuring covers from the glorious sixties along with some original songs. He plays solo or with electric guitar accompaniment, delivering soulful, nostalgic Americana tunes in intimate local venues.

Lucky Strike
Led by Joe Lococo, the Lucky Strike band is a fixture in the San Francisco Bay Area music scene, known for playing blues, jazz, and rock & roll. The group delivers high-energy performances at established venues, drawing on Lococo's experience as a sideman and bandleader.

Lucky Losers
The Lucky Losers are San Francisco’s premier six-piece blues-soul band. Fronted by fiery Dallas-raised vocalist Cathy Lemons and New Jersey harmonica master/vocalist Phil Berkowitz, the group delivers a throwback mix of blues, soul, rock, gospel, and Americana with impassioned vocals and electrifying interplay. Gaucho Jazz
Gaucho is a masterful Bay Area band that combines the influence of gypsy jazz of 1930’s Europe with the rhythmic drive and collective improvisation of New Orleans swing music, gutbucket blues and elements of ragtime. Andean and Latin World Music Night
Two-time Latin Grammy nominee Eddy Navia and Quentin Navia are joined by master violinist Georges Lammam, dancers and dancing. Their performances blend the charango (a traditional ten-string instrument), haunting sounds of panpipes (zampoñas) and notched flutes (kena) with high-energy rhythms. Blues Power
Blues Power is a San Francisco blues project led by Mark Naftalin, known as a legendary pianist, producer, and blues advocate. The core band members typically include Mark Naftalin on keyboards, along with a rotating lineup of top Bay Area blues musicians such as bassist Dave McDaniel and drummer Sam Chapman.
